The Aufguss UK Championships will be held on 18 and 19 May in London.

The British Sauna Society will collaborate with Dr. Martha Newson from the University of Greenwich on the UK Aufguss Championship to investigate the impact of sauna culture on wellbeing.

The British Sauna Society has been associated with the Dr. Martha Newsonof the University of Greenwich in Londonto carry out an investigation during the UK Aufguss Championshipfocusing on the impact that sauna culture has on physical, mental and social well-being.

Those with tickets to the event, which will be held on the following days 18-19 May at The Arc, Canary Wharf (London)will be invited to participate in a before and after survey to use the Aufguss sauna for up to 65 persons.

The results obtained will form part of Dr. Newson's study on the power of sauna rituals to foster group cohesion, create community through shared experiences and reinforce a sense of belonging.

Ritual and Community: Newson's Scientific Approach

During the Summit Saunawhich will take place the following day (20 May), Newson will give a keynote address entitled "The Power of Ritual. In her talk, the Associate Professor of Psychology will explain how ancestral practices align with current scientific findings, why rituals are more necessary than ever in a fragmented world, and how we can consciously use them to build stronger communities.

In addition to its work at Greenwich, Newson leads the Changing Lives Lab research group at Oxford University.where he has delved into how rituals shape collective identity and strengthen group resilience, whether in a football stadium or in sacred ceremonies.

"In other regions, such as Scandinavia and Japan, sauna use is collective - supporting the idea that shared experiences can strengthen social bonds and improve mental and physical health," says Dr Newson.

"Despite the growth of sauna use in the UK, there has been little research into how the culture compares to other traditions and its potential to promote collective wellbeing," he adds.

"This study will provide valuable information about the psychological effects of sauna useand how the individual and social aspects of these rituals influence relaxation and mental health. The results will contribute to the scientific literature and enrich the debate on holistic wellness practices, benefiting sauna users, wellness professionals and public health experts alike".

UK Aufguss Championship 2025

This year's championship is expected to be the largest to date, with a international jury of experts which will evaluate participants on the basis of technique, narrative and sensory experience.

The event will take place in The Arcthe largest sauna centre in the United Kingdom, founded by Chris Miller (former Soho House and currently CEO of hospitality innovation firm White Rabbit Projects). The site has the largest sauna in the countryintegrated sound and lighting systems, eight Brass Monkey ice baths and specific areas for Aufguss actions.

Sauna Summit - 20 May 2025

The Summit Sauna will be a day of keynotes, panel discussions on building a sauna community in the UK and networking opportunitieswhich will culminate in the award ceremony to the winners of the Aufguss UK.
